July 1, 2008 - In last week's episode, the topsides received the 2nd coat of color, and is settling out for another round of wet sanding and final coat. The centerboard was final painted and re-installed as well.In this weeks show, I final prepped and primed the hull and bottom. The bottom received a rolled on coat of 2-part barrier primer.The original gelcoat water line varied from 3/4" to 1-3/4"in width, and meandered some, so I have masked off a better contoured line down to 3/4" wide which is more proportionate with the boat's wide stripe under the rubrail. The hull and bottom colors start going on this weekend.The new replacement rubrail came in from D&R Marine. They are suppliers of OEM O'Day and Pearson parts. The original rubrail was in tact but pretty sun beaten.
